refactor(3p/nix/libexpr): Use absl::btree_map for AttrSets
This is the first step towards replacing the implementation of attribute sets with an absl::btree_map. Currently many access are done using array offsets and pointer arithmetic, so this change is currently causing Nix to fail in various ways.
